Details
The PASF-60.24 is a one phase power supply unit with an integrated output-relay fit for the demanding solutions. It offers maximum functionality for applications in complex systems and machines. The power supply steps down the voltage from 230V AC to 24V DC. Output voltage can be adjusted with a trimmer (+-8%). Thanks to the extremely space-saving narrow design, they are particularly suitable for industrial applications in switch boxes or in small control cabinets. To increase the output power, several power supply units of the same type can be connected in parallel. Warning! Improper use can lead to hazards such as short circuit, fire, electric shock, etc.
Functions and features:
Output | ||
---|---|---|
Rated output voltage | 24 V DC | |
Rated output current | 2.5 A | |
Rated output power consumption | 60 W | |
Output voltage adjustment | ±8 % | |
Pulse voltage alteration, max. | 120 mV | |
Input | ||
Voltage limits | AC | 85...264 V, 45...65 Hz 85...264 V, 45...65 Hz |
DC | 110...370 V | |
Current consumption | 1.25 A | |
Inrush current | 36 A | |
Efficiency | 85% | |
ADC resolution | 12 bit | |
Protection | ||
Output current limit | 104 ... 116% of rated current | |
Output voltage limit | 150% of rated voltage | |
IP Code | IP20 | |
Environmental conditions | ||
Ambient temperature | -40...+70 °C | |
Transportation and storage | -40...+50 °C | |
Enclosure | ||
Weight | max. 0.5 kg |
